Output 74dafd58a78c210f15e9440bd704b286a83e02eed06b2ca41a70923b58fa89a3:6

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81ceae7740384631d0a9f045720013f8235e82ae OP_EQUALVERIFY OP_CHECKSIG
address
1CqMmEHLizBEQtnzaChCdRcsSPZ49w5rpX
transaction
74dafd58a78c210f15e9440bd704b286a83e02eed06b2ca41a70923b58fa89a3
spent
true